Its decoration based on strokes Muslims, and altars covered with gold leaf and fruit shapes, birds and carved faces, make this unique architectural gem American Baroque. Has enormous religious significance because his altar lie the remains of St. Marion of Jesus, protector of the capital
Iglesia y Monasterio de San Francisco), commonly known as el San Francisco, is a 16th-century Roman Catholic complex in Quito, Ecuador. It fronts onto its namesake Plaza de San Francisco.
Plaza Grande is the principal and central public square of Quito, Ecuador. This is the central square of the city and one of the symbols of the executive power of the nation. Its main feature is the monument to the independence heroes of August 10, 1809
